logo image
/ Code&IT / Vanna: Your AI Business Intelligence Assistant
Vanna: Your AI Business Intelligence Assistant image
Vanna: Your AI Business Intelligence Assistant
5
ADVERTISEMENT
  • Introduction:
    Vanna is an AI-driven Python library that creates SQL for databases, serving as a business intelligence aide.
  • Category:
    Code&IT
  • Added on:
    Aug 20 2023
  • Monthly Visitors:
    39.0K
  • Social & Email:
ADVERTISEMENT

Vanna: Your AI Business Intelligence Assistant: An Overview

Vanna is an advanced AI-powered Python package designed to streamline the process of generating SQL queries for various database systems, including Snowflake, BigQuery, Athena, and Postgres. Functioning as a business intelligence assistant, Vanna facilitates the rapid creation of intricate SQL queries tailored to your specific database schema.

Vanna: Your AI Business Intelligence Assistant: Main Features

  1. AI-driven SQL query generation
  2. Compatibility with Snowflake, BigQuery, Athena, Postgres, and other databases
  3. Customizable training models for database-specific query generation
  4. Self-learning capabilities to enhance accuracy over time
  5. Secure and private management of database information
  6. Integration options with Jupyter Notebook, Slackbot, web applications, and more

Vanna: Your AI Business Intelligence Assistant: User Guide

  1. Install the Vanna Python package using pip.
  2. Obtain and set up your API key for authentication.
  3. Specify the database model that Vanna will use for training.
  4. Utilize the 'ask' function to input your queries.
  5. Receive SQL queries generated by Vanna in a matter of seconds.

Vanna: Your AI Business Intelligence Assistant: User Reviews

  • "Vanna has transformed the way we handle data queries. The speed and accuracy of SQL generation are impressive!" - Alex R.
  • "As a non-technical user, I can easily extract insights from our databases thanks to Vanna’s intuitive interface." - Jamie L.
  • "The integration with our existing tools has been seamless, making Vanna an essential part of our workflow." - Morgan T.
  • "I love how Vanna learns from my queries. It has significantly improved its suggestions over time." - Casey P.

FAQ from Vanna: Your AI Business Intelligence Assistant

Which databases can I connect to using Vanna?
Vanna is compatible with a variety of databases, including popular options like Snowflake, BigQuery, Athena, and Postgres. Additionally, it offers flexibility for integration with other database systems.
How does Vanna maintain precision in SQL creation?
The precision of SQL generation by Vanna is influenced by the quality and quantity of the training data it receives. Providing extensive and diverse datasets, particularly for intricate scenarios, enhances its accuracy.
Is it possible to utilize Vanna with my custom database setup?
Absolutely! Vanna enables you to develop a tailored model that aligns with your specific database and schema requirements. Your data and model remain confidential and are not shared unless you opt to do so.
Will Vanna evolve and enhance its capabilities over time?
Indeed, Vanna is designed for continuous improvement. As you interact with it, the model learns from your inputs and gradually refines its SQL generation skills, leading to enhanced performance.
Open Site

Latest Posts

More